Your mental health assessment is completed during the initial evaluation appointment. The initial appointment covers the clinical evaluation and any diagnosis provided, if applicable.
The written mental health assessment report is a separate document and is only released upon purchase. Client’s often use these for
-Short-term or long-term disability claims
- Court proceedings or custody matters
-Personal injury or motor vehicle accident cases
-Workers’ compensation claims
-Emotional support animal (ESA) documentation
-Fitness-for-duty evaluations
